Output 3d3bdf13ecaaff7798cc229d1ec6ef78394aed2405c6e0314c496a2fbb508981:0

value
17062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d2fdc9464f4d4104b6aa974297bea5c767c1d19462dd0f7f5475549862b568d
address
bc1pm5hae9ry7n2pqjm2496zj7l2t3m8c8gegckapal4ga25np3t26xsd26wc3
transaction
3d3bdf13ecaaff7798cc229d1ec6ef78394aed2405c6e0314c496a2fbb508981
confirmations
86508
spent
true